Specification Brand : NOYITO BulletPoint1 : The MCP4725 is a single-channel 12-bit buffered voltage output DAC with non-volatile memory (EEPROM). BulletPoint2 : The user can store configuration register bits (2 bits) and DAC input data (12 bits) in non-volatile EPROM (14-bit) memory. BulletPoint3 : The DAC can be configured for normal mode or power saving shutdown mode by setting the configuration register bit. BulletPoint4 : The device can use a 2-wire I2C-compatible serial interface and is powered from a single supply with a voltage range of 2.7V to 5.5V. BulletPoint5 : This board breaks out each pin you will need to access and use the MCP4725 including GND and Signal OUT pins for connecting to an oscilloscope or any other device you need to hook up to the board. Also on board are SCL, SDA, VCC, and another GND for your basic I2C pinout. The MCP4725 is an I2C controlled Digital-to-Analog converter (DAC). A DAC allows you to send analog signal, such as a sine wave, from a digital source, such as the I2C interface on the Arduino microcontroller. Digital to analog converters are great for sound generation, musical instruments, and many other creative projects!
